Responsibilities

  • Greet patients and visitors into the clinic in a prompt, courteous and professional manner.
  • Obtain all appropriate forms as required.
  • Obtain demographic and insurance information. Obtain copy of patient’s insurance cards and current driver's license for file.
  • Update demographic and insurance information as needed in the system.
  • Register all new patients into the system.
  • Notify nursing staff of patient arrivals, placing charts in appointment order.
  • Assist in preparing charts for next day’s appointments and prints schedules as needed.
  • Collect co-pays, deductible and other out of pocket amounts at time of visit. Issues receipts if necessary.
  • Distribute condolence cards to patients families as requested.
  • Maintain lobby area in a neat and orderly manner.
  • Identify no shows and forwards for patient notification.
  • Demonstrate an understanding of patient confidentiality to protect the patient and clinic/corporation.
  • Follow policies and procedures to contribute to the efficiency of the front office.
  • Cover for other front office functions as requested
